Word:

Hirsute

Pronunciation:

/ˈhəːsjuːt/ | hir·​sute

Part Of Speech:

Adjective

Derivatives:

Hirsutism and hirsuties, synonymous nouns naming a medical condition involving excessive hair growth; hirsutal, an adjective meaning “of or relating to hair”; and hirsutulous, a mostly botanical term meaning “slightly hairy” (as in hirsutulous stems). 

Meaning:

  • hairy
  • covered with coarse stiff hairs

Related Phrases:

Synonyms:

  • hairy
  • shaggy
  • bushy
  • long-haired
  • woolly
  • furry
  • fleecy
  • unshorn
  • stubbly
  • hispid

Antonyms:

  • hairless
  • short-haired
  • shorn
  • bald
  • glabrous
  • smooth

Phrases/Informal Synonyms:

Word Origin:

early 17th century: from Latin hirsutus.

Usage Note:

Mostly used with a humorous undertone.

Use In Sentences:

  1. The hirsute teenager was warned that he would be expelled from school if he did not take a haircut and pay attention to his grooming.
  2. Nitin always wears a t-shirt to the pool so that others won’t laugh at his hirsute chest.
  3. Reena is a hirsute woman and whenever she is around we try not to notice her moustache.
  4. The balding man visited the salon for a hirsute makeover.
